How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Actually Works

With water removal, it’s not just about sucking up the water and calling it a day. Our team follows a rigorous process to ensure that every last drop is removed, and that your home is restored to its pre-damage condition. We’ll work tirelessly to:

Step 1: Assess and Contain the Damage

Our technicians will arrive on-site,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and contamination. We’ll use advanced equipment to measure water levels, detect hidden moisture, and identify potential safety hazards.

Step 2: Remove Standing Water

We’ll use powerful pumps and water extraction equipment to remove standing water from your home, reducing the risk of secondary damage and contamination. Our technicians will work efficiently to complete this step within 60-90 minutes.

Step 3: Dry and Dehumidify

Next,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your home, walls, and belongings.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th, warping, and other long-term damage.

Step 4: Sanitize and Clean

Once the water has been removed and the area is dry, our technicians will sanitize and clean the affected area to prevent bacterial growth and contamination.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your family and pets.

Step 5: Document and Restore

Finally, we’ll document the entire process, including before-and-after photos, to support your insurance claims and ensure smooth reimbursement. Our team will work closely with you to restore your home to its pre-damage condition, including replacing damaged materials and repairing affected areas.

Warning Signs You Need Dishwasher Leak Water Removal

Recognizing the warning signs of a dishwasher leak is crucial in preventing long-term damage and costly repairs. Keep an eye out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home, it could be a sign of hidden moisture or bacterial growth. Our team can help you identify the source and develop a plan to remove it.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ains on walls and ceilings are a clear indication of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ore these signs, call our team to inspect and remediate the damage before it’s too late.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of excess moisture or water damage. Our team can help you restore your floors to their original condition, including replacing damaged materials and repairing affected areas.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. Our team can help you identify the source and develop a plan to restore your walls to their original condition.

Mineral Deposits and Water Rings

Mineral deposits and water rings on surfaces can be a sign of excess moisture or water damage. Our team can help you identify the source and develop a plan to restore your surfaces to their original condition.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ak with minimal water damage Yes No You can likely handle a small leak and clean-up with basic equipment and DIY skills.
Large leak with significant water damage No Yes A large leak needs professional equipment and expertise to prevent secondary damage and contamination.
Hidden moisture or water damage behind walls or ceilings No Yes Hidden moisture or water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and remediate.
urgency due to flooding or burst pipes No Yes Urgency due to flooding or burst pipes needs prompt and professional attention to prevent catastrophic damage and safety hazards.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Cost in Grand View, ID

The cost of dishwasher leak water removal services in Grand View, ID can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. As a general est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a small to moderate-sized leak. But, prices can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more for larger or more complex jobs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small leak removal and clean-up $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area and local conditions
Medium-sized leak removal and clean-up $1,000 – $3,000 Severity of damage and complexity of job
Large leak removal and clean-up $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and required equipment
Hidden moisture or water damage remediation $1,500 – $4,000 Complexity of job and required equipment

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and can vary depending on your specific situation. For a more accurate quote, we recommend scheduling a free on-site assessment with our team.
